Worst years for a Harley-Davidson Flhtcutg
Owners have filed 107 complaints about the Harley-Davidson Flhtcutg with NHTSA across model years 2009 to 2024. More of them are about the engine & cooling than anything else.
Avoid
2011 Harley-Davidson Flhtcutg15 complaints — the highest FaultScore of any year, mostly engine & cooling.
Cleanest on record
2015 Harley-Davidson Flhtcutg10 complaints — the lowest FaultScore of the graded years.
Every Harley-Davidson Flhtcutg year, graded
The grade compares each year against the rest of this model's own run — never against another car. Click any bar or row to open that year's report.
| Year | Grade | Complaints | Crashes | Fires | Median miles | Most reported |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2024 | — | 2 | 0 | 0 | — | Transmission & Drivetrain |
| 2023 | — | 1 | 0 | 0 | — | Lights |
| 2022 | — | 3 | 0 | 0 | — | Transmission & Drivetrain |
| 2020 | — | 4 | 2 | 0 | — | Brakes |
| 2019 | — | 9 | 3 | 0 | 9,477 | Brakes |
| 2018 | — | 8 | 0 | 0 | — | Transmission & Drivetrain |
| 2017 | D | 14 | 1 | 0 | 2,500 | Engine & Cooling |
| 2016 | — | 3 | 0 | 0 | — | Electrical System |
| 2015 | D | 10 | 1 | 1 | 21,880 | Engine & Cooling |
| 2014 | — | 7 | 1 | 0 | 9,980 | Brakes |
| 2013 | — | 7 | 0 | 0 | 600 | Engine & Cooling |
| 2012 | — | 9 | 5 | 0 | — | Brakes |
| 2011 | F | 15 | 1 | 0 | 787 | Engine & Cooling |
| 2010 | D | 10 | 1 | 0 | 2,241 | Engine & Cooling |
| 2009 | — | 5 | 0 | 1 | 1,500 | Engine & Cooling |
